Avatar
主页博客项目关于
资源
  • 代码
  • 图库
  • 音乐

气质猫咪

一个专注于ts全栈开发的个人博客

导航

  • 首页
  • 博客
  • 项目
  • 关于

资源

  • 代码
  • 图库
  • 音乐

技术栈

  • Next.js 15
  • React 19
  • TypeScript
  • tRPC

Copyright © 2025 at 气质猫咪

heroui产品过滤

17 个文件
2025年11月25日

产品过滤组件,这是components下面的一个组件,没有全部上传,此组件稍微有些复杂,由于过滤存在大量子组件向父组件通信,所以使用了大量的forwardRef,最外面的index.tsx是父组件,layout和filter为左侧子组件,products为右侧子组件,左侧 子->父,父传参给右侧子组件

herouifilterproduct

代码文件

product-filter
data
filters
layout
products
index.tsx
types.ts
product-filter/data/filter-items.ts

演示图片